Sportworks have recently teamed up with the English Lacrosse Association (ELA) to deliver the National Schools Competition at the Imperial College Sport Ground, London, in March 2012.

The National School's Competition was established for the U19 and U15 girl age groups, allowing the top teams in the country to compete together. Lacrosse currently has a growing profile within the UK and the ELA aim to persist with improving the participation figures to, eventually, convey a more even geographical spread throughout the nation. It is felt that with the presence and support of an organisation such as Sportworks this can be achieved. Coupled with this strategy the ELA are looking to build upon the recent successful hosting of the World Championships in Manchester, and growth in participation rates across the UK by continuing with the long-term aim to gain Olympic status.

Traditionally, the American and Canadian community had primarily played lacrosse, until around 20 years ago, when Britain and Australia began to participate more seriously. Historically it is a fast paced, tiresome, energetic game, deeply rooted in Native American history. Originally the game was executed to resolve conflicts over a large areas often resulting in violence with the potential for the individuals to be involved for days at a time. Nowadays there is a clear difference between women's and men's lacrosse.
